Corrective Development Contract and Special Assessment Agreement
dated June 14, 2006, by and between the CITY OF CHANHASSEN, a
Minnesota municipal corporation ["City"]; and PAUL T. EIDSNESS and
ANDREA S. EIDSNESS f/k/a ANDREA S. JOHNSON, husband and wife,
[hereinafter referred to as the "Developer"].
This Corrective Development Contract and Special Assessment
Agreement is given to correct the legal description of the property used in a
former Development Contract and Special Assessment Agreement between the
parties hereto, dated February 13, 2006, and recorded in the Office of the
Registrar of Titles for Carver County, Minnesota, on February 15, 2006, as
Document No. T 157034.
RECITALS
A. The Developer has applied to the City for the subdivision of the
land described on into two lots, one of which lots is legally described on the
attached Exhibit "A" ["Assessed Parcel"]. The City has approved the
subdivision subject to certain conditions including that the Developer enter
into this Agreement.
B. As a condition of subdivision approval, the City required the
construction of a street. The Developer has asked the City to construct the
street as a public improvement project.
NOW, THEREFORE, IN CONSIDERATION OF THEIR MUTUAL
COVENANTS, THE PARTIES AGREE AS FOLLOWS:
1. Public Improvements. The City shall construct a public street in
the public easement as described on Exhibit A ["Easement Premises"]. Street
construction may commence, in the City's discretion, upon the occurrence of
any of the following events, whichever first occurs: when property immediately
abutting the Assessed Parcel to the east is further subdivided, when a building
permit is issued for construction on the Assessed Parcel, when the property to
the north of the Assessed Parcel is developed, or when the City determines it is
appropriate to construct the street.
2. Surface Water Management Fees. As a condition of subdivision
approval the Developer is required to pay a surface water quality fee of $2,383
and a surface water quantity fee of $5,987. The Developer has asked to defer
payment of the fees until one of the events triggering the street construction
referred to in paragraph 1 above occurs.
3. Special Assessments. Parcel B is specially assessed for: [1] street
project in the amount of $10,000.00; [2] the surface water quality fee in the
amount of $2,383; and [3] the surface water quantity fee in the amount of
$5,987. The assessments shall be deemed adopted on the date this Agreement
is approved by the City Council. The assessments shall be deferred without
interest until the street is constructed. When the deferment ends, the
assessments shall be paid over a five [5] year period, together with interest
commencing as of the date the deferment ends at a rate of eight percent [8%]
per year on the unpaid balance.
4. Waiver. The Developer waives any and all procedural and
substantive objections to the improvements and the special assessments,
including but not limited to hearing requirements and any claim that the
assessment exceeds the benefit to the property; and further waives any appeal
rights otherwise available pursuant to M.S.A. ~ 429.081.
